Also, the go-to literature for the design and analysis of PT members is contradictory. For any designer working globally, these two code documents define the design of post-tensioned members. Three issues specific to the design of post-tensioned members are currently treated differently by the American Concrete Institute’s Building Code Requirements for Structural Concrete and Commentary, ACI-318 (2014), and Europe’s Design of Concrete Structures – Part 1-1 General rules and rules for buildings, European Code EC2 (2004). In this case, the industry may need to start a conversation with code authorities for clarification. When major building codes are not in agreement on specific structural members, confusion and uncertainty are propagated among design engineers.
